Power Inductor & 2 in 1 Transformer < SMD Type: CLS Series>  
Type: CLS6D28  
Description  
4 Terminal pins’ type gives a flexible design as inductors or transformers.  
Can also be used as a coupled inductor, two single inductors connected  
in parallel, as 1:1 transformer or as an autotransformer when connected  
in series.  
Core material: Ferrite.  
Custom design is available.  
Feature  
Max. Operating frequency: 1MHz.  
2 in 1 Coils for high efficiency up-down DC-DC converters.(SEPIC, Zeta, Cuk converter).  
Storage temperature range: -40~+105.  
Operating temperature range: -40~+105(including coil’s self-heat).  
Product weight: 520mg(Ref.).  
Ideally used in the power supply for DSCNote PCDVC and W-LED backlighting.  
RoHS Compliance.

1. ( ) typical value.  
2. Saturation Current: The DC current at which the inductance decreases to 90% of it’s nominal value.  
3.Temperature rise current: The DC current at which the temperature rise is t40.(Ta20).
